Official PC System Requirements

The requirements are surprisingly approachable for a modern AAA release, though hitting high-fidelity visuals will require beefier hardware. Here’s a quick breakdown:

ComponentMinimumRecommended
OSWindows 10 (64-bit)Windows 10 (64-bit)
CPUIntel Core i5-8500 / AMD Ryzen 5 2600XIntel Core i5-11600K / AMD Ryzen 5 5600
RAM16 GB16 GB
GPUNVIDIA GTX 1060 / AMD RX 6500 XTNVIDIA RTX 2080 / AMD RX 6700 XT
DirectX1212
Storage135 GB SSD135 GB SSD

Performance Insights

  • CPU Matters: The Blackspace Engine thrives on strong single-core performance, especially in dense city areas and physics-heavy combat. Minimum CPUs like the i5-8500 can run the game, but for smooth 60 FPS in chaotic fights, the i5-11600K or Ryzen 5 5600 is more realistic.
  • Graphics and Visuals: GTX 1060 is fine for 1080p low settings, but for cinematic fidelity, an RTX 2080 or RX 6700 XT is the baseline. Ray tracing and 4K performance will demand top-tier GPUs like the RTX 4080 or upcoming 50-series cards.
  • Memory and Storage: 16 GB RAM is now standard, but the SSD requirement is non-negotiable. Any HDD will likely choke on texture streaming and seamless world traversal.
  • Mac Players: Surprisingly, macOS support is official. Minimum: M1 with 16 GB RAM. Recommended: M4 Pro or M3 Pro with 16 GB RAM.
  • Controller Friendly: Mouse and keyboard work, but a controller is strongly recommended for the fluidity of combat and exploration.

In-Game Graphics Tweaks: Where the Magic Happens

The Black Space Engine is gorgeous but heavy. Tweaking the following can stabilize FPS without killing visuals.

  • Resolution & Super Sampling: Stick to your monitor’s native resolution. Use DLSS or FSR instead of dropping the resolution—it’s the cleanest way to save FPS.
  • Ray Tracing: The biggest FPS killer. Disabling it can boost performance by 30–50%. For mid-range rigs, consider keeping it off.
  • Particles & Combat Effects: Disabling particles entirely can save tons of FPS during massive fights. Combat telegraphs become trickier, but smooth gameplay wins.
  • Texture & Draw Distance: 8GB VRAM? Medium textures. 12GB+? High/Ultra. Reduce draw distance if your CPU struggles in forests or cities.
  • Post-Processing: Medium Volumetric Fog/Clouds usually looks fine and saves FPS. Shadows: High is enough—Ultra rarely justifies the drop.

Windows & Driver Optimization: Squeeze Every Bit

  • Update GPU drivers regularly (NVIDIA/AMD).
  • Enable Windows Game Mode to prioritize system resources.
  • Enable Hardware-Accelerated GPU Scheduling (HAGS) for lower latency and smoother DLSS Frame Generation.
  • Use High Performance or Ultimate Performance power plan to avoid CPU throttling.

Hardware-Specific Tips

  • SSD Installation: The game world is seamless, so NVMe SSD is essential to avoid texture pop-ins or hitching across Pywel.
  • CPU Priority: 3D V-Cache CPUs like Ryzen 7800X3D shine here because of all the environmental calculations.
  • RAM Management: Close background apps like Chrome or launchers to ensure full memory access.
